Transaction 63fc5dd8215fee21a4d207e9c2da340f73dfef5b7bebb27743d5b6bc72131d96

1 Input
2 Outputs
  • 63fc5dd8215fee21a4d207e9c2da340f73dfef5b7bebb27743d5b6bc72131d96:0
  • value  25787710
    address  3EFHdEJpUskNuyBnqC6W4E51HV9q32xJr2
  • 63fc5dd8215fee21a4d207e9c2da340f73dfef5b7bebb27743d5b6bc72131d96:1
  • value  157287290
    address  16dtNhRxJATZozyDb4nWjvCxSZ5uwTh7HA